“…Two main sub-sections characterize a complete wearable medical device [ 81 ]: the hardware subsector, comprising sensor selection and characterization, noise removal from the collected data, and communication with a data processing subsystem. The other sub-sector, the software, comprises data processing and decisions based upon the collected data, in which AI techniques can be used for representing, modeling, and reasoning with medical evidence and knowledge, potentially demonstrating human-like capabilities for diagnosis, early detection, prevention and medical care guidance [ 82 ]. Therefore, in addition to remote and continuous motoring, prediction and recommendations with the data collected through wearable devices may potentially enhance SWS capabilities [ 81 ].…”
